Service Intervals & Maintenance Schedule

Maintaining your vehicle in top condition doesn't have to be a hassle. A well-structured service/maintenance/inspection schedule can help you avoid costly repairs down the road and keep your car running smoothly for years to come. Manufacturers recommend/suggest/provide specific intervals for various services, based on factors like mileage, driving conditions, and engine type. These schedules usually outline essential/regular/routine tasks such as oil changes, tire rotations, brake inspections, filter replacements, and fluid checks.

Sticking to a detailed/comprehensive/organized service schedule is crucial for ensuring your vehicle's longevity and performance. By attending to these tasks promptly/on time/regularly, you can maximize/enhance/improve fuel efficiency, prevent wear and tear on components, and ultimately extend/prolong/increase the lifespan of your vehicle.
